Fig. 4. EPR of singly and doubly spin-labeled Tau derivatives gives access to Tau side-chain dynamics and intramolecular distance information.

(A) Local side-chain dynamics accessed by cw EPR of 28 μM singly spin-labeled Tau derivatives: Rotational correlation times τcorr determined in the absence (dark gray) and presence (light gray) of 56 μM Hsp90 and respective changes Δτcorr (purple/pink) are shown. Arrows indicate a decrease (pink) or increase (purple) in side-chain mobility at the respective site. (B) Intramolecular distance information obtained by DEER spectroscopy with doubly spin-labeled Tau derivatives: Effective modulation depths Δeff determined in the absence (dark gray) and presence (light gray) of Hsp90 and respective changes ΔΔeff (light/dark green) are shown. Arrows indicate a decrease (light green) or increase (dark green) in spin label separation.
